To observe the clinical effects of Shaoyao Mugua Decoction in treatment of posterior circulation ischemia vertigo(PCIV).Methods:A total of 98 patients with PCIV admitted to Shunyi Hospital of Beijing Hospital of Traditional Chinese Medicine from March 2018 to June 2019 were selected as the research objects and were randomly divided into a control group and an observation group in accordance with the random number table,with 49 cases in each group.The control group was given betahistine mesylate,and the observation group was given Shaoyao Mugua Decoction combined with acupuncture on the basis of the control group.The changes of traditional Chinese medicine syndrome score,DHI scale,TCD index and FIB before and after treatment were compared between the 2 groups,and the clinical efficacy of the 2 groups was evaluated.Results:There was no significant difference in TCM syndrome score,DHI score,TCD index and FIB between the 2 groups,compared with those before treatment(P>0.05).After treatment,the TCM syndrome score,DHI score,TCD index and FIB of the 2 groups were significantly lower than before treatment(P<0.05).The total effective rate in the observation group was 89.36%(42/47),significantly higher than that in the control group(67.67%,33/48),with statistically significant difference(P<0.05).Conclusion:Shaoyao Mugua Decoction combined with acupuncture for the treatment of PCIV patients can significantly increase clinical efficacy,relieve clinical symptoms,reduce the pain,promote patients' recovery,which has obvious advantages and is worthy of application.
